What Are Mobile Power Trailers?

When the grid goes down or a job site needs power before permanent utilities arrive, mobile power trailers keep operations running. Generators and power distribution equipment are only as effective as the trailer platform carrying them, and a poorly designed transport solution can delay deployment and increase the risk of equipment damage before a single kilowatt is produced.

 

Mobile power trailers are purpose-built platforms designed to carry, protect, and transport generator sets and power distribution equipment safely between facilities and deployment sites. These trailers are used by construction crews, equipment rental companies, utility operators, event production teams, emergency response organizations, and industrial facilities that depend on reliable mobile power wherever it is needed.

 

Unlike standard flatbed trailers, mobile power trailer designs must account for generator weight, vibration during transport, cable and distribution panel access, and how crews need to connect and configure equipment quickly in the field. A platform that does not address those factors creates unnecessary setup time and operational risk at every deployment.

Common Uses and Benefits of Mobile Power Trailers

Mobile power systems serve a wide range of industries and operational scenarios. Construction crews, rental fleets, utilities, and emergency responders all depend on reliable generator transport to maintain productivity and respond quickly when power is needed.

Common applications include:

Construction site temporary power

Emergency and disaster recovery response

Utility maintenance and outage restoration

Equipment rental fleet deployment

Event and entertainment production power

Military and defense field operations

Remote industrial site power supply

Telecommunications and infrastructure backup

Film and broadcast production support

Custom trailer designs provide several advantages over modified standard platforms. Power equipment can be transported more safely when the trailer is designed around the specific generator it carries. Proper mounting configuration, vibration management, and cable access contribute to more reliable deployment and reduced stress on valuable equipment over time.

Durability is another major benefit. Generator trailers face repeated loading, highway transport, and demanding field deployment cycles. Heavy-duty construction helps extend trailer service life while reducing maintenance demands. Fleets also benefit from improved operational efficiency because properly organized cable access and mounting systems allow crews to set up and break down faster at every stop.

These advantages translate into lower operating costs and better deployment productivity over time. Investing in a custom mobile power trailer helps organizations protect their generator assets and maximize uptime across changing sites and schedules.
